日粮中添加葡萄皮渣对绵羊生长性能、器官指数及血液生化指标的影响

摘    要:本研究在绵羊日粮中添加一定量的葡萄皮渣,旨在研究其对绵羊生长性能、器官指数及血液生化指标的影响。试验选取24只5月龄、体重25 kg左右的杜泊羊×小尾寒羊杂交公羊,采用完全随机设计分为4组,每组6只,分别饲喂不同葡萄皮渣添加水平(0、5%、10%、20%)日粮。结果表明,10%添加组日增重(ADG)显著高于0、5%添加组(P<0.05);10%添加组肝脏及肾脏重量显著高于0、5%添加组(P<0.05);10%和20%添加组的大肠重量显著高于其他两组(P<0.05);添加葡萄皮渣能极显著增加皱胃重量(P<0.01)。适量添加葡萄皮渣能显著提高绵羊血清高密度脂蛋白胆固醇(HDL-C)含量,其中以10%添加水平最高(P<0.05);谷丙转氨酶(ALT)与谷草转氨酶(AST)变化趋势相同,均以5%添加组最低,显著低于0、20%添加组(P<0.05);与未添加组相比,5%添加组绵羊血清肌酐(CRE)含量显著降低(P<0.05),而总抗氧化能力(T-AOC)明显提高(P<0.05);过氧化氢酶(CAT)活性以20%添加组最高,显著高于其他3组(P<0.05)。由以上结果可知,日粮中添加一定量的葡萄皮渣可提高绵羊日增重,促进肝脏、肾脏及消化器官的发育,增加血清高密度脂蛋白胆固醇含量,提高血清抗氧化水平。综合各个指标,葡萄皮渣添加量以10%为宜。

Effect of Dietary Grape Pomace on Growth Performance,Organ Index and Blood Biochemical Indexes in Sheep

Abstract:This experiment was aimed to investigate the effect of grape pomace on growth performance,organ index and blood biochemical indexes in sheep.A total of 24 hybrid 5-month-old Dorper (♂)×Small Tail Han sheep (♀) F1 male lambs weighted at 25 kg were randomly divided into 4 groups with 6 lambs per group.All these sheep were fed diets with the addition of grape pomace at 0,5%,10%,20% on a dry weight basis, respectively.The results showed that the ADG in group 10% was extremely significantly higher than that in group 0 and 5% (P<0.01),and the weights of liver and kidney in group 10% were notably higher than that in group 0 and 5% (P<0.05).The weights of large intestinein in group 10% and 20% were obviously higher than that in the other two groups (P<0.05).The weights of abomasum were extremely significantly increased in grape pomace supplemental groups (P<0.01).Grape pomace could significantly improve serum HDL-C,and it was the highest in group 10% (P<0.05).ALT and AST had the same variation trend,they were the lowest in group 5%,and the values in group 5% were significantly lower than that in group 0 and 20% (P<0.05).Compared with group 0,the serum CRE in group 5% was significantly decreased (P<0.05),while the serum T-AOC significantly improved (P<0.05).The CAT enzyme activity was highest in group 20%,it was higher than the other groups (P<0.05).In conclusion,adding grape pomace properly could improve ADG,promote development of liver,kidney and digestive organs,increas serum HDL-C level,and improv the level of serum antioxidant.Taking all factors into account,dietary supplementation with 10% of grape pomace was advisable.
